Are there any age restrictions for specific positions at Food Lion?

At Food Lion, age restrictions vary depending on the specific position and location. For example, Food Lion typically requires applicants to be at least 16 years old to work in part-time or seasonal roles, such as store associates or cashiers. However, some positions, like management or department manager roles, may require applicants to be at least 18 or 21 years old, depending on the specific store and state laws. Additionally, Food Lion often hires teenagers for part-time jobs, offering flexible scheduling to accommodate students and young adults. When applying, it’s essential to review the specific job requirements and age restrictions for each position, as well as comply with federal and state labor laws. By understanding these requirements, applicants can find suitable job opportunities at Food Lion that align with their age and qualifications.

How many hours can I work at Food Lion as a teenager?

As a teenager looking for a job at Food Lion, you’ll be pleased to know that many stores offer flexible scheduling options to accommodate students’ school and extracurricular commitments. Typical working hours for Food Lion teenagers range from 15 to 30 hours per week, depending on store location, position, and management policies. During the school year, it’s common for high school students to work part-time hours outside of school hours, usually between 4 pm to 10 pm, Monday through Friday, and on weekends, typically 9 am to 7 pm. Keep in mind that summer months often offer more extended working hours, sometimes up to 35 hours or more per week. As you navigate applying and scheduling with Food Lion, be sure to communicate your availability and academic needs to your manager to ensure a mutually beneficial arrangement. By asking the right questions and understanding their specific needs, you can find a schedule that helps you succeed in your role while also reaping the benefits of your Food Lion job as you take on more hours.

Are there any specific documents I need to apply for a job at Food Lion?

When applying for a job at Food Lion, it’s essential to have the necessary documents ready to ensure a smooth application process. Typically, Food Lion job applications require you to provide proof of identity, work eligibility, and education. You’ll need to present a valid government-issued ID, such as a driver’s license or passport, and documents that verify your work authorization, like a work permit or Social Security card. Additionally, be prepared to provide proof of your educational background, such as a high school diploma or GED certificate. Food Lion may also request references or previous work experience documentation to support your application. It’s a good idea to review the job description and requirements carefully to determine if any specific certifications, licenses, or training are needed for the position you’re applying for. By having all the necessary documents ready, you can efficiently complete your application and increase your chances of moving forward in the hiring process.

What kind of positions are available for teenagers at Food Lion?

Teenagers have a variety of positions available to them at Food Lion, offering valuable work experience and the chance to develop essential skills. One of the most common roles is the Cashier, a position that requires managing transactions, handling money, and providing excellent customer service, which can be a great starting point for any teenager. Additionally, Stock Associates are in demand to help keep stores well-stocked and organized, which can involve lifting heavy items and maintaining a clean workspace. For those interested in more customer-facing roles, Customer Service Representatives play a crucial part in ensuring a positive shopping experience. This involves greeting customers, assisting with product locations, and handling any inquiries or issues. Additionally, Food Lion often offers opportunities for teenagers to work in departments like Deli, Bakery, or Preparation Kitchen, where they can gain experience in food handling and customer service. These positions not only provide a steady income but also valuable resume-building experience and important life skills such as teamwork, time management, and communication.

What is the minimum wage for teenagers at Food Lion?

Food Lion, like many retail employers, adheres to state and federal labor laws, which dictate the minimum wage for teenagers. While the federal minimum wage applies to all employees, states can set their own minimum wages, often surpassing the federal rate. To determine the exact minimum wage for teenagers at Food Lion in your specific location, it’s best to consult your state’s Department of Labor website or directly contact Food Lion’s human resources department. Remember that factors like age, experience, and specific job duties may also influence an employee’s hourly rate.
